All you need to know about working as a supply teacher is in this book. Experienced supply teacher Glen Segell tells you everything he wished he'd been told before embarking on supply teaching and had instead to learn for himself.

The handbook provides full and up to date information on:

the qualifications you need to be a supply teacher, whether or not UK-trained
supply and supply agencies
securing work and your legal status as a supply teacher
supply teaching as a career - short or long term
educational provision in England, Wales and Scotland
government, local authority and school initiatives such as Excellence in Cities

It tells you:

what to do when you first arrive at a school
how to fit in with the way the school works - including the staff-room
how to operate in the classroom and keep the students learning
what you need to know about the curriculum
your position regarding homework

There is a guide to terminology, a list of useful organisations such as the GTC and even guidance on remuneration for your work.
This constructive and accessible book will make life more enjoyable for supply teachers and their work more effective. It will be of value to supply agencies and the schools which regularly buy in supply. And no supply teacher can afford to be without it.

Dr Glen Segell has taught in over 60 schools over the past four years.
